Sloth

Sloth is a powerful macOS utility that provides a graphical interface for viewing all open files, directories, sockets, and other system resources in use by running processes. It offers real-time monitoring and filtering capabilities, making it an essential tool for developers and system administrators who need to troubleshoot or understand system resource usage.

Sloth displays all open files, directories, sockets, pipes, and devices in use by running processes on macOS.

Pros

  • + Provides a user-friendly GUI for system resource monitoring, making it accessible to both developers and non-technical users.
  • + Real-time updates and filtering capabilities enhance its utility for troubleshooting and system analysis.
  • + Open-source with a permissive BSD-3-Clause license, fostering community contributions and transparency.

Cons

  • - The app icon display issue on certain macOS versions may affect user experience.
  • - While the GUI is helpful, some users might prefer the command-line functionality of lsof.

SSDReporter Free

SSDReporter Free is a dedicated SSD health monitoring tool that provides detailed insights into your SSD's condition. It offers early warnings of potential issues, making it ideal for Mac users concerned about data security and storage reliability.

Monitors and reports the health of SSDs, offering insights into their condition.

Pros

  • + Dedicated SSD health monitoring tool
  • + Provides early warnings of potential issues
  • + Free to use

Cons

  • - Lack of auto-update feature
  • - Niche appeal, only useful for specific users
